The word 'middelbareschoolleerling' is a Dutch noun meaning 'secondary school student'. It's a compound word divided into eight syllables: mid-del-ba-re-scho-ol-leer-ling, with primary stress on 'leer'. Syllabification follows vowel-based rules, consonant cluster preservation, and digraph treatment. Schwa reduction and regional 'r' variations are potential considerations.
